Definition of couple in English
The most common way to say “casal” in English is “couple”.
This word is used to describe two people in a romantic relationship. In English, “couple” can also refer to two items or people who are together in some way. The versatility of the term allows its use in different contexts, always indicating a union of two elements.
How to use couple in English in practice
You can use “couple” in various situations, such as:
They make a lovely couple. They make a lovely couple.
The couple celebrated their anniversary. The couple celebrated their anniversary.
There are a couple of things we need to discuss. There are a couple of things we need to discuss.
The context and intonation help determine whether the reference is more personal or generic.
When to use (and when not to use) "casal" in English
Use “couple” to refer to two people in a relationship or two items that are together. In formal situations or in writing, “couple” is appropriate and clear.
Avoid using “couple” when referring to a larger group of people or items. In this case, words like “group” or “several” are more suitable. In very informal contexts, expressions like “pair” might be more appropriate.
12 ways to say couple in English
Couple
Standard English form for a pair.
Pair
Two people or items together.
Duo
Two individuals acting together.
Twosome
Informal term for a couple or duo.
Partners
Two people in a relationship.
Lovebirds
Slang for a couple in love.
Significant other
Formal term for a partner in a couple.
Better half
An affectionate way to refer to your partner.
Spouses
Legally married couple.
Romantic pair
Two people in a loving relationship.
Dynamic duo
Two people who work well together.
Married couple
Couple who has formalized their relationship.
